Swedish
Etymology
mod (“(positive) state of mind”) + stulen (“stolen”)
Adjective
modstulen (comparative mer modstulen, superlative mest modstulen)
- sad and dispirited (from disappointment or trying circumstances); discouraged, dejected, crestfallen
- Synonym: modfälld
